5 Reasons To Not Miss Champions; Mzansi Magic's Brand-new Telenovela Set To Premiere Tonight

Image
The countdown for the premiere episode of the telenovela  Champions  has begun. Viewers across Southern Africa are just a few hours away from the big night that will kick off the first episode of the brand-new story of passion, love, power and perseverance.  Champions  premieres on channel 161 tonight at 19:00 and will be available on DStv Stream. The show’s star-studded cast as announced in early January includes Sello Maake ka-Ncube, Tumisho Masha, and Jo-anne Reyneke, Kgomotso Christopher, Kwenzo Ngcobo, Thembinkosi Mthembu, Thato Dithebe and breakout duo of Rethabile Mohapi and Minkie Malatji. Here are some of the reasons why you should be locked to your screens Monday to Friday at 19:00: Champions  “theme song” : Afro-soul musician Keabetswe “KB” Motsilanyane is the voice behind the  Champions  theme song. Big Brother Mzansi Sammy M’s Dream for the R2m Grand Prize Ends as she becomes second housemate to be Evicted

Image
Last night was a wrap of a highly dramatic week with an equally dramatic live eviction show with Sammy M becoming the second housemate to be evicted from the Big Brother Mzansi S'ya Mosha house. Her eviction follows a nomination show that saw the Head of House, Disruptor Neo, saving and replacing McJunior with Zee. In her on-stage interaction with host Lawrence, Sammy M shed light on the nature of her relationship with Willy and described him as a crush that turned into a kissing buddy. She let the audience in on where her mind was in the house, saying she did not want to wear her heart on her sleeve and reveal her feelings for him. Meanwhile, in the house, the housemates expressed an expected shock at her departure, with Yolanda visibly devastated by this eviction. It may be considered an unexpected reaction from Yolanda when Sammy M described her as the one housemate she couldn't stand in the house. Real Housewives Of Johannesburg star Thobekile Mdlalose demystifies African spirituality at schools

Image
The businesswoman, healer and reality TV star recently spoke at her high school on her calling  KWAZULU-NATAL: The school curriculum for 2024 has started. Learners from all walks of life gather at schools. From different religions; Islamic, Christian, Hindu, and so forth. Among these are those who also practice African spirituality – which in some schools and communities has been seen as ungodly, evil, dirty, and taboo. Self-made millionaire, traditional healer, philanthropist, and Real Housewives Of Johannesburg reality star, Thobekile Mdlalose hopes to help demystify African spirituality, especially at schools and education institutions where some learners and students find themselves having to advance on a spiritual journey. Tyla Wins Grammy for Best African Music Performance

Image
South African singer Tyla won a Grammy in the category of Best African Music Performance on Sunday. The artist won the award for her afropiano and R&B song  Water , which has reached global popularity and made various achievements. Tyla beat other African stars, including Burna Boy, Ayra Starr, ASAKE & Olamide and Davido featuring South African artist Musa Keys.  Tyla's hit single "Water" peaked last month at number 7 on  the Billboard Hot 100 chart . "Oh my - what the heck!" Tyla said at the start of her acceptance speech. "Oh my gosh, guys. This is crazy. Like I never thought I'd say, 'I won a Grammy at 22 years old, guys'," she said. The Recording Academy did not make Tyla sweat as the Johannesburg-born singer took home the Grammy for Best African Music Performance in the category's first year.
